Tipping Point fans were blown away by a scouse contestant's sweet gesture on today's show.
Ben Shephard welcomed four new contestants to take on the arcade style machine in the latest episode of the ITV show.
One of today's players was Zoe, a sports science student from Liverpool, who put her general knowledge to the test to see if she could win the £10,000 cash prize.

The student pitted her wits against SJ, Andy and Alan - and successfully navigated her way to the final.
Ben Shephard quizzed what Zoe planned to do with the winnings and fans loved her heart-warming response.
She said: "I'd love to spoil my mum a little bit.
"She's given up a lot and she's at the time in her life where she should be able to relax a little bit and not worry about us three kids."
Tipping Point viewers took to Twitter to say they were now rooting for Zoe to win.
One fan wrote: "That's a nice thing to do."
Another commented: "Treating her mam how nice."
A third said: "I hope she wins now"
Zoe gambled to try and win the jackpot and came nail-bitingly close to taking home the £10,000 but fell just short - meaning she left empty-handed.
